AnyaBASIC is a portable Interpreted Programming Language made in Java. It has a syntax similar to BASIC with a bit of C, Javascript and PASCAL thrown in.
This is a "Toy Language", so don't expect much. However, while this started as a "joke", this language evolved into something which is capable of doing a lot more(games, graphics, etc). It's also a language whose keywords are in English so it should be a good language to use in teaching kids how to program.

How to run the sample codes
$java -jar AnyaBasic.jar <source.abs>
- Just type the above line on the terminal/console or
- Double click any of the
runxxxxxx.bat
for Windows users. - For graphics and sound apps, you need to include the lib path:
$java -Djava.library.path=. -jar AnyaBasic.jar <source.abs>
- See the batch and SH files in the samples section.
- You can also use the accompanying ConTEXT editor as an IDE to make coding a bit easier.
